Axis Bank, boAt & Mastercard Unveil Smartwatch with Tap-to-Pay Feature!

Axis Bank, one of the largest private sector banks in India, announced today its collaboration with boAt, India’s leading wearable brand, and Mastercard, a global leader in payment technologies.

This partnership aims to seamlessly integrate tap-and-pay NFC-enabled payments into the newly launched ‘Wave Fortune’ smartwatch.


Priced competitively at ₹3,299 (with a special offer price of ₹2,599), the Wave Fortune is designed to empower users with convenience, security, and an enhanced smartwatch experience.

Axis Bank cardholders can now securely tokenize and store their debit and credit cards on the Wave Fortune Smartwatch via Crest Pay, boAt’s official payment app, allowing for effortless contactless payments. This feature—powered by Mastercard’s tokenization technology and supported by the robust infrastructure of TAPPY Technologies—enables single-step payments of up to ₹5,000 at POS devices without the need to enter a card PIN, ensuring both speed and security.

The payment system, powered by Mastercard, allows users to securely tokenize and store their cards within the smartwatch strap for quick and seamless transactions. Axis Bank credit and debit cardholders using Mastercard and VISA networks will continue to enjoy the rewards and benefits associated with their cards while making payments with the Wave Fortune smartwatch.
